Abstract
본 발명은 선택적 오동작 방지 정전압회로에 관한 것으로서, 이는 전원전압이 일정 이상의 전압으로 입력되면 정전압발생수단의 정전압을 일정기간 동안 유지시켜 정상적으로 출력하고 전원전압이 과도한 전압으로 입력될 경우에는 정전압 발생수단의 정전압을 영전위로 감소시켜 회로의 보호 및 오동작을 방지하도록 한것이다. 이와 같은 본 발명은 전압분압수단으로 부터 분압되어 어어진 전압의 레벨을 검출하여 일정전압 이상일 경우 정전압발생수단의 정전압을 영전위로 유지시키는 분압전압검출수단과, 상기 분압전압검출수단에서 얻어진 전압에 따라 스위칭되어 정전압발생수단에서 얻어진 전전압을 제어하여 출력하는 정전압제어출력수단을 포함하여 이루어짐으로써, 달성된다.The present invention relates to a selective malfunction prevention constant voltage circuit, which maintains the constant voltage of the constant voltage generating means for a predetermined period when the power supply voltage is input at a predetermined voltage or more, and outputs normally when the power supply voltage is input at an excessive voltage. The constant voltage is reduced to zero potential to prevent circuit protection and malfunction. The present invention as described above detects the level of the voltage divided by the voltage dividing means and, if a predetermined voltage or more, divided voltage detecting means for maintaining the constant voltage of the constant voltage generating means at zero potential, and according to the voltage obtained by the divided voltage detecting means. It is achieved by including a constant voltage control output means that is switched to control and output the full voltage obtained from the constant voltage generating means.
